| S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C - FOUNDATION COMPONENTS - DISC - ROTOR | ||||||||||||||||
| 91V134000 |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| V (Vehicle) | 325000 | 09/26/1991 | ODI | FORD MOTOR COMPANY | 08/06/1991 | 08/07/1991 | ||||||||
| Defect Summary | Front disc brake rotors of the subject vehicles may experience severe corrosion if operated in areas where calcium chloride and sodium chloride are used extensively. | |||||||||||||||
| Consequence Summary | Severely corroded rotors may fracture or separate nearthe inner edges of the brake discs resulting in reduced braking effectiveness,higher than normal pedal efforts, loud grinding noises, and moderate pulls whenthe brakes are applied. reduced braking effectiveness may increase minimumstopping distances, possibly resulting in an accident. | |||||||||||||||
| Corrective Summary | Replace front brake rotors with full cast front brake rotors. | |||||||||||||||
| Notes | System: brakes.vehicle description: passenger vehicles sold or registered in the following states: ct, il, in, me, ma, mi, nh, nj, ny, oh, pa, ri, vt, and wi. | |||||||||||||||
